About ANVESHAN

ANVESHAN is a flagship student research convention initiated by AIU in 2007 to identify and nurture outstanding research talent among students. The winners at the university level will represent Assam Don Bosco University at the Zonal Level ANVESHAN 2025–2026 to be held at Apex Professional University, Arunachal Pradesh.

Categories for Participation

Students are invited to submit research projects under the following six areas:

  • Agriculture
  • Basic Sciences
  • Engineering & Technology
  • Health Sciences and Allied Subjects
  • Social Sciences, Humanities, Commerce, and Law
  • Interdisciplinary Research

Eligibility & Nomination

  • Projects must be nominated by the respective Heads of Departments
  • A maximum of two projects per department may be nominated
  • Participants must be full-time bonafide students (UG to PhD level)

Guidelines for Participants

  • Projects should be original, innovative, and feasible
  • Group projects may have up to four members
  • Presentations may be in the form of posters, models, demonstrations, or oral presentations
  • The competition will consist of two rounds:
    • Poster Presentation
    • Oral/Podium Presentation (for shortlisted participants)
